Output 8dcae12688e30a875b1f2f75921aeca3fcf3c7672f36d550a07b141ed9604c51:4

value
88753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 653ba002e4b3cf82f80616254a81f123f841a3be OP_EQUAL
address
3AvHbjqLHwmPGv2TBAyQFNDsFGAhnmaJiE
transaction
8dcae12688e30a875b1f2f75921aeca3fcf3c7672f36d550a07b141ed9604c51
confirmations
499291
spent
true